Michigan's climate presents unique challenges for exterior surfaces. Winter's freeze-thaw cycles can damage siding and concrete, while summer's humidity promotes mold and mildew growth. These seasonal shifts mean proactive cleaning is essential. Our services address the specific needs driven by Michigan's weather patterns, ensuring your home withstands the elements.

We understand the housing stock in areas like Grand Rapids and Ann Arbor, which often features a mix of historic brick, vinyl siding, and wood. Each material requires a tailored approach to pressure washing. Our technicians assess your home's construction and condition to apply the correct pressure and cleaning agents. This prevents damage and maximizes cleaning effectiveness, preserving your home's curb appeal and structural integrity.

What is the difference between pressure washing and power washing?

While often used interchangeably, power washing uses heated water for tougher grime, whereas pressure washing uses unheated water. Both methods effectively clean exterior surfaces in Michigan. The choice depends on the specific cleaning challenge your home presents.
